Bush and Beach Itinerary

Day 3

Visit the Ngare Ndare Forest and enjoy a bit of time out of the vehicle. Visit the ‘Blue Pools” and take a swim in the icy mountain water or opt for the canopy walk suspended at 30m above the ground. This suspension bridge runs for 400m through the forest at canopy level, allowing you to spot forest birds – Hartlub’s Turaco being one, Narina’s Trogan and Cask Hornbills. There is a large platform located at the end of the canopy walk where lunch will be served. Your lunch setting has a fantastic view of the river below where elephant and buffalo are often found having a swim themselves.

Bush and Beach Itinerary

Day 4

Enjoy a morning horse-ride, a fantastic way to experience the wildlife on the conservancy. Borana is equipped with two sets of stables, each of which caters to riders of varying experience. Our larger stables cater to the more advanced rider, with thoroughbred horses leading rides for over two hours across the conservancy. Stables for the less advanced riders (small children included) are on the Eastern side of Borana Conservancy and run at a much slower pace. The grooms are very happy taking children for short rides on lead reigns which is a great way to build up their confidence.

Bush and Beach Itinerary

Day 7

A 20 minutes boat ride from Manda Bay is the historic town of Lamu, which is a must for any guest interested in culture and a little history. Lamu Town is the oldest continuously inhabited town in East Africa which has a mix of Swahili, Arabic and Portuguese cultures. Little has changed since the turn of the century and a guided tour is a fascinating way to spend a morning. There are many small shops where you can buy some locally crafted silver, wooden carvings and fabrics. The nearby village of Shella is an interesting place to visit and see some of the more modern buildings that have developed in the last 30 years.
